Where You'll Go

Stop 1

Maya Bay

The legendary bay made famous by "The Beach." Walk its white sand shores and photograph the dramatic limestone cliffs, ringed on three sides by sheer rock. Landing is closed Aug 1–Sep 30 annually for marine conservation — during that window the boat still takes you past Maya Bay for distance sightseeing and photos, just without going ashore.

Stop 2

Pileh Lagoon

A hidden emerald-green lagoon enclosed by towering cliffs. Swim in its dazzling waters, cut off from the world — this is usually the stop guests photograph the most, since the cliffs on all sides make the water look almost unnaturally bright.

Stop 3

Viking Cave

Ancient wall paintings and thousands of swiftlet nests cover the cave walls — a glimpse into the island's history.

Stop 4

Monkey Beach

Playful macaques roam freely here — observe them from a safe distance for a uniquely wild encounter. Keep bags zipped and food out of sight; the macaques are used to boats arriving and aren't shy about investigating anything left within reach.

Best Time to Visit

Outside the Maya Bay closure window (August 1–September 30), the dry season from November to April gives the calmest crossing and best underwater visibility for snorkeling at the other stops. The wet season (May to October, minus the Maya Bay closure) brings shorter afternoon showers rather than all-day rain, and the tour still runs — the open-sea crossing to Phi Phi is longer than our Racha or Khai routes, so if you're prone to seasickness, bring tablets regardless of season.
